The story of Nancy Jeanette McGee began in 1822 in Georgia. Nancy Jeanette McGee married Jesse Lacey Revel, and had children including Camelia M Dudley, Jane Revell, Sarah T Revel, William B Revel. Nancy Jeanette McGee passed away in 1908 in Russell County, Alabama.
